Ustadha Shamira Chothia Ahmed
Born in Northern California, Shamira Chothia Ahmed is an emerging young, female teacher of the traditional Islamic sciences. Her studies led her to seek knowledge from scholars on three continents — Africa, Europe, and Asia. Upon receiving ijaazas (authorizations) to teach, she was granted the opportunity to be an instructor of Hanafi fiqh for women at the Zaytuna Institute in Hayward, California. Privately, she taught fiqh (jurisprudence), tajwid (cantillation) and Qur’anic tafsir (exegesis). She recently completed her M.A. in the Social Sciences at the University of California, Irvine, and teaches classes on hadith to sisters in the Southern California region.
